It's the first episode that Kim Manners directed - he was a legendary TV director who came out of semi retirement to work on Supernatural. He was with the show until he passed away a few years later. Jared and Jensen still credit him with a lot of what makes it such a special place to work. (Also, occasionally you'll hear the line "kick it in the ass" or a variation. That is a tribute to Kim - it was his phrase.) The layers you begin to see in Dean in this episode, is what I find the most intriguing.
